Agricultural Market Information System (AMIS)

 

OECD contributes actively to the Agricultural Market Information System (AMIS), called for by G20 Agriculture Ministers with the aim of addressing food price volatility through more timely, accurate and transparent information on global food markets.

AMIS seeks to strengthen collaboration and dialogue amongst the main producing, exporting and importing countries. The focus of AMIS is on four crops that are particularly important in international food markets, namely wheat, maize, rice and soybeans.
